William Barnes 1827 – 1892 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: abt 1827

Birth Location: Great Chart, Kent, England

Death Date: Jun 1892

Death Location: West Ashford, Kent, England Ref 2a/435

Father: Robert Barns

Mother: Mary Ashman

Spouse(s): Jane Kirby

Children(s): George Barnes

William Barnes was born in 1827 in Great Chart, Kent, England, the child of Robert Barns and Mary Ashman. William Barnes married Jane Kirby, and had children including George Barnes. William Barnes passed away in 1892 in West Ashford, Kent, England Ref 2a/435.
